New Cross Fire Station Open Day - 16 Aug 2025
The New Cross Fire Foundation (NCFF) had an interesting and fulfilling experience at the New Cross Station open day on 16 August.
The NCFF has a strong partnership with the LFB and the two organisations are working together on a range of initiatives, including public and community engagement.
The NCFF used the open day to launch phase one of its public consultation regarding a new national monument to the 1981 New Cross Fire.
This initial phase of consultation involves ideas-gathering and listening to people about how a monument might make them feel, what emotions it might evoke, and what form or features might best reflect those feelings and emotions. Several different engagement methods were provided, including a questionnaire and a word-cloud activity.
It proved to be a busy day and virtually everyone who attended the open day engaged with the NCFF stall and participated in the consultation!
